Output 99a36344c2773cc703a19f5c2003094cb66df91eb5578c23dcf94e6cafdcfbfb:24

value
35261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42e9811b0a72c0aa06e2c7ed1aed059eca9ee02 OP_EQUAL
address
3J7jNUwMAccFqE1Bnkvrao3NnMb5CubAPg
transaction
99a36344c2773cc703a19f5c2003094cb66df91eb5578c23dcf94e6cafdcfbfb
confirmations
252000
spent
true